Corey Harawira-Naera looking for bigger Raiders role



Canberra forward Corey Harawira-Naera says he’s got plenty more to offer the Raiders after notching two tries off the bench in their comeback win against the Warriors.

“I don’t know how (coach Ricky Stuart is) gonna work it in the next few weeks, but I feel like it’d be a good idea if Elliott (Whitehead’s) old body isn’t getting bashed around every week and to try and give him a little bit of a spell,” he said. “But I’m happy to play anywhere, centre, back row, middle, wherever ‘Stick’ wants to chuck me.

Read more: https://canberraweekly.com.au/corey-har ... ders-role/

Tapine and Tino set for heavyweight bout

A colossal battle between Joe Tapine and Tino Fa'asuamaleaui on Saturday should get fans salivating.

"That'll be a good match-up, big Tino and 'Taps' going at it, I'll have front row seats to watch that," he said. "It's a group effort, you can't take him one-on-one, I'll be looking to get the big boys around me and we'll look to get in his face early so he doesn't get a roll on.
